The contract solicitation is for a vacuum gauge indicator with NSN 6685-01-545-5673, issued by the Defense Logistics Agency under the Department of Defense, with a purchase request quantity of three units. The solicitation number is SPE4A5-26-T-211P, published on June 3, 2026, and responses are due by June 11, 2026. The NAICS code 334513 indicates the product falls under the category of instrumentation manufacturing. There is no specified set-aside type, and the contract is open to federal procurement without geographic restrictions for performance or delivery. The solicitation is managed electronically through the DIBBS system with no listed point of contact, and all bidding must be submitted via the provided online portal.

The Defense Logistics Agency Land and Maritime is soliciting quotations for the procurement of two battery assemblies, identified by NSN 6140-01-664-6369, under solicitation SPE7L7-26-Q-2417. The required delivery timeframe is 60 days after receipt of order, with the place of performance located at FPO 09592. Award will be determined based on the best value to the government, evaluating technical acceptability, price, and past performance regarding offered delivery. This contract carries stringent security and regulatory requirements, including CMMC Level 2 certification and compliance with DFARS 252.204-7012 for safeguarding covered defense information. Technical data is subject to ITAR and EAR export controls, requiring contractors to have approved US/Canada Joint Certification Program certification and completed specific DLA export-control training. Additionally, the items are classified as hazardous materials, requiring the submission of Material Safety Data Sheets and certification via HAZDEC forms in accordance with FED STD 313D. Packaging and marking must adhere to MIL-STD-2073-1E Level B (Pack Code Q) and MIL-STD-129. Inspection and acceptance will occur at the origin, with DCMA inspection limited to kind, count, and condition. Invoicing and payment processing must be conducted electronically through the Wide Area WorkFlow system.
